Boeing
Delta 4 and Sea Launch to Explore Mutual Backup Plan

Boeing Expendable Launch Services and
Sea Launch have signed a memorandum of understanding to develop a
commercial agreement providing mutual back-up between Boeing's
Delta 4 family of launch vehicles and Sea Launch's Zenit 3SL. The
two companies are still discussing how to share the cost of
implementing such an agreement for issues such as the development of
techniques and adapters to allow the rapid shift of a satellite from
one vehicle to another.
